Piutau didn't meet the threshold for a Super Rugby contract. When he didn't make the ABs I didn't think him signing for Ulster was the reason. But now I suspect it was a contributing factor. Was a fair enough move by the NZRU to cut a player that wasn't committed to the cause.
"Piutau had hoped to play for the Blues in next season's Super Rugby competition before linking up with Ulster but the move was blocked by New Zealand Rugby, who wanted to protect the pathway to national teams.
He didn't meet the threshold for a Super Rugby contract only, which requires New Zealand eligible players to have played Super Rugby level for at least five years".
http://m.nzherald.co.nz/sport/news/article.cfm?c_id=4&objectid=11511106
